Conditions Clindamycin Gel TreatsClindamycin Gel is a prescription based medicine licensed for the treatment of acne. The medicine is primarily recommended for treating severe forms of acne lesions. The drug is conceived from the essential presence of the antibiotic agent- clindamycin phosphate. Therefore, the gel is greatly effectual at killing the infestation of acne-causing bacteria. It further prevents the bacterial organisms on the skin to release proteins essential for their growth and proliferation. This reaction of the drug consequently inhibits the bacteria from replicating and growing in number. Clindamycin Gel Side EffectsClindamycin Gel is bound to trigger certain unwanted reactions in the body, especially after its first few dosages. Some of the most tolerable forms of side effects of the drug are dryness, itching on the treated region of the skin, accumulation of oil, appearance red colored rashes. These after-effects are most of the times short-termed and hence do not call for any medical attention. |
